Best Vacaville Public High Schools (2026)

For the 2026 school year, there are 7 public high schools serving 5,850 students in Vacaville, CA.
The top-ranked public high schools in Vacaville, CA are Buckingham Collegiate Charter Academy, Kairos Public and Vacaville High School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Vacaville, CA public high schools have an average math proficiency score of 27% (versus the California public high school average of 28%), and reading proficiency score of 47% (versus the 51% statewide average). High schools in Vacaville have an average ranking of 5/10, which is in the bottom 50% of California public high schools.
Vacaville, CA public high school have a Graduation Rate of 88%, which is more than the California average of 86%.
The school with highest graduation rate is Buckingham Collegiate Charter Academy, with ≥95% graduation rate. Read more about public school graduation rate statistics in California or national school graduation rate statistics.
Minority enrollment is 66%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the California public high school average of 79% (majority Hispanic).
